Understanding Bath Chairs

Bath chairs are specially designed seats that provide support and stability during bathing. They come in various styles and configurations to cater to different needs and preferences. Common types include:

  1. Standard Bath Chairs These are simple, sturdy chairs without any additional features. They typically have non-slip rubber feet and a backrest for support.

  2. Bath Transfer Benches Designed to extend over the edge of the bathtub, these benches allow users to sit down outside the tub and slide over into the bathing area, reducing the risk of slipping.

  3. Shower Chairs Shower chairs are similar to bath chairs but are specifically designed for use in the shower. They often come with adjustable heights and non-slip feet to ensure stability on wet surfaces.

  4. Foldable Bath Chairs These chairs can be folded for easy storage and transport. They are ideal for individuals who need a portable solution or have limited bathroom space.

Benefits of Using Bath Chairs

  1. Enhanced Safety One of the primary benefits of bath chairs is the enhanced safety they provide. By offering a stable seat, they significantly reduce the risk of slips and falls in the bathroom, which can be particularly dangerous for elderly individuals or those with mobility issues.

  2. Increased Comfort Bath chairs offer a comfortable seating option, making the bathing experience more pleasant. Users can sit down and relax while bathing, which is especially beneficial for those who find standing for extended periods challenging.

  3. Promotes Independence Bath chairs enable individuals to bathe independently, preserving their dignity and self-esteem. This independence is crucial for maintaining a positive outlook and quality of life.

  4. Versatility Bath chairs come in various designs and features, making them suitable for a wide range of needs. Whether you require a basic chair for occasional use or a more advanced model with added features, there is a bath chair to suit your requirements.

  5. Ease of Use Most bath chairs are designed to be user-friendly, with simple assembly and adjustment mechanisms. This ease of use ensures that both users and caregivers can set up and use the chair without difficulty.

Choosing the Right Bath Chair

When selecting a bath chair, consider the following factors to ensure you choose the right one for your needs:

  1. Weight Capacity Ensure the bath chair can support the user’s weight. Most chairs have specified weight limits, so choose one that comfortably accommodates the user.

  2. Adjustability Look for chairs with adjustable height settings to ensure a comfortable fit. Adjustable legs can help achieve the correct height for safe and comfortable bathing.

  3. Comfort Features Consider additional features such as padded seats, backrests, and armrests for added comfort. These features can make a significant difference in the user’s experience.

  4. Non-Slip Design Safety is paramount, so choose a bath chair with non-slip feet or suction cups to ensure stability on wet surfaces.

  5. Portability If you need a portable solution, look for foldable or lightweight bath chairs that can be easily transported and stored.

How Bath Chairs Improve Daily Life

Bath chairs play a crucial role in enhancing the daily lives of individuals with mobility challenges. Here are some ways they make a difference:

  1. Safety and Peace of Mind Bath chairs provide a secure and stable seating option, reducing the risk of accidents in the bathroom. This safety feature provides peace of mind for both users and their caregivers.

  2. Comfort and Relaxation Bath chairs offer a comfortable seating option, allowing users to relax and enjoy their bathing experience. This comfort is especially beneficial for individuals with chronic pain or fatigue.

  3. Independence and Dignity By enabling individuals to bathe independently, bath chairs help maintain their dignity and self-respect. This independence is vital for mental and emotional well-being.

  4. Ease for Caregivers Bath chairs make it easier for caregivers to assist with bathing, reducing the physical strain and making the process more efficient and less stressful.
